Building enterprise solutions for federal missions shouldn't take longer than the threat cycle they're designed to address. But complex data, siloed systems and fragile integrations keep teams stuck in build mode while adversaries move at mission speed. That's not sustainable.
In this session, we'll show how developers can use PDP Xgentic within the Progress Data Platform to rapidly build and deploy mission-ready applications.
By unifying structured and unstructured data with context and governance, the platform enables teams to streamline development, reduce integration overhead and deliver reliable, governed AI solutions — applications that turn complex data into operational intelligence, for any domain, at the speed the mission actually requires.
